  <refname>array_reduce</refname>
  <refpurpose>Iteratively reduce the array to a single value using a callback function</refpurpose>
 </refnamediv>
 <refsect1>
  <title>Description</title>
  <methodsynopsis>
   <type>mixed</type><methodname>array_reduce</methodname>
   <methodparam><type>array</type><parameter>input</parameter></methodparam>
   <methodparam><type>callback</type><parameter>function</parameter></methodparam>
   <methodparam choice="opt"><type>int</type><parameter>initial</parameter></methodparam>
  </methodsynopsis>
  <para>
   <function>array_reduce</function> applies iteratively the
   <parameter>function</parameter> function to the elements of the
   array <parameter>input</parameter>, so as to reduce the array to
   a single value. If the optional <parameter>initial</parameter> is
   available, it will be used at the beginning of the process, or as
   a final result in case the array is empty.
   If the array is empty and <parameter>initial</parameter> is not passed,
   <function>array_reduce</function> returns &null;.
  </para>
  <para>
   <example>
    <title><function>array_reduce</function> example</title>
    <programlisting role="php">
<![CDATA[
<?php
function rsum($v, $w)
{
    $v += $w;
    return $v;
}

function rmul($v, $w)
{
    $v *= $w;
    return $v;
}

$a = array(1, 2, 3, 4, 5);
$x = array();
$b = array_reduce($a, "rsum");
$c = array_reduce($a, "rmul", 10);
$d = array_reduce($x, "rsum", 1);
?>
]]>
    </programlisting>
   </example>
  </para>
  <para>
   This will result in <varname>$b</varname> containing
   <literal>15</literal>, <varname>$c</varname> containing
   <literal>1200</literal> (= 10*1*2*3*4*5), and
   <varname>$d</varname> containing <literal>1</literal>.
  </para>
